Transaction 01a3266b69496579d4d0cd7b5442d89dcd5de655d3fbf160e1611fd60db951d3

1 Input
2 Outputs
  • 01a3266b69496579d4d0cd7b5442d89dcd5de655d3fbf160e1611fd60db951d3:0
  • value  327800
    address  35x2chvPeuADg7j9D6SBuXBJZKdEGh3E3C
  • 01a3266b69496579d4d0cd7b5442d89dcd5de655d3fbf160e1611fd60db951d3:1
  • value  28039968
    address  3Pg7KADUyUPALEiQ2cS9FZx3WxEdLFApTe